Output f1a05ae5c868c66cffb0e26a444de3a451de809ab6b8a0f43adcec80daeceba2:0

value
25605494
script pubkey
OP_0 OP_PUSHBYTES_32 053c78a05b37cf7281f4222abff94c280681e57f43017efca0c21f5c6ef3fd0b
address
bc1qq5783gzmxl8h9q05yg4tl72v9qrgretlgvqhal9qcg04cmhnl59sjlhp3m
transaction
f1a05ae5c868c66cffb0e26a444de3a451de809ab6b8a0f43adcec80daeceba2
confirmations
3907
spent
true